Fresh off of coming in second on The Mask (and making weird comments about how God chose for him to be “The Donut”) John Schneider was out on Twitter threatening the lives of President Biden and his son Hunter:
It’s hardly surprising that someone who is famous for driving a car called “The General Lee” is out here calling for a left-leaning President to be lynched.
He deleted the post pretty quickly, and now is claiming that he never meant to threaten President Biden’s life: “Despite headlines claiming otherwise, in my post, I absolutely did not call for an act of violence or threaten a U.S. president as many other celebrities have done in the past. I suggest you re-read my actual post and pay attention to the words before believing this nonsense.â
Despite that very convincing denial, he’s now being investigated by the Secret Service.
Vanity Fair has a great oral history of Conan O’Brien’s first year hosting The Late Show, and one of the heroes that emerges was his friend/sometime girlfriend Lisa Kudrow who always knew O’Brien would be chosen as the host: “I donât know how much we talked about it. I just knew, ‘Youâre trying to replace David Letterman. No one replaces David Letterman. Youâre no one.’ [Laughs.] It canât be anybody that an audience would know.” And she was right!

Jacklyn Zeman, the actress who played Nurse Bobbie Spencer on General Hospital for 46 years, passed away in May of this year. The show will finally mark her passing in two special episodes next month. (I suspect they waited so long to honor her because the writers’ strike was happening, and they wanted the regular staff to write the special episodes, but I could be wrong.)
